According to Flapen's Amazon United States niche tracking, pulp riot purple is a $63K/yr Amazon United States market (286K searches/yr). The top 5 brands hold 100% of demand. Demand peaks in Jan–Feb–Mar–Dec. Verdict: Skip it — 40/100.

Common questions

Is pulp riot purple profitable to sell on Amazon United States?
The niche generates $63K/yr across 25 tracked products. 8 of 8 products launched in the last 360 days are still selling. 90-day search growth is -3.5%. Flapen's verdict: Skip it (40/100).
How competitive is the pulp riot purple niche?
1 brands and 49 sellers compete. The top 5 products take 47% of clicks and top 5 brands hold 100% of demand.
What do buyers complain about in pulp riot purple?
Top complaints mined from reviews: Color, Suitability Colored Hair, Functionality-Overall. The return rate is 1.1%.
When does demand for pulp riot purple peak?
Demand peaks in Jan–Feb–Mar–Dec; the busiest month runs 9.5× the quietest.
What does it cost to enter the pulp riot purple niche?
Listings span $10.61–$15.91; the average listing price is $14.09 (sweet spot $15–$100). The average incumbent carries 280 reviews — the moat a new listing must climb.
